Embodiment 1
[0038] Such as figure 1 and figure 2 As shown, a device for electroplating small holes on the parts of the control rod drive mechanism, a device for electroplating small holes on the parts of the control rod drive mechanism, including a device for fixing the electrode rod 4 on the part 1 during electroplating The positioning cap 3 on the axis of the part hole 2;
[0039] The positioning cap 3 is a cylindrical structure with a circular cross-sectional shape, and the material of the positioning cap 3 is an insulating material;
[0040] The axis of the columnar structure is provided with a central hole 32 for piercing the electrode rod 4, and the positioning cap 3 is also provided with at least two air holes 31. 31 is a through hole arranged on the positioning cap 3, and the length direction of the through hole is parallel to the axial direction of the central hole 32. Embodiment 3
[0056] Such as figure 1 and figure 2 As shown, the present embodiment is further limited on the basis of embodiment 1: as a further technical solution of the above-mentioned device for electroplating small holes on control rod drive mechanism parts:
[0057] In order to make the positioning cap 3 suitable for the electroplating of the component holes 2 within a certain size range and realize the versatility of the positioning cap 3, the shape of the positioning cap 3 is truncated cone. Compared with the positioning cap 3 with a cylindrical shape, this solution can be fixed in the component hole 2 within a certain inner diameter range through an interference connection.
